We decided to try this place out last night (3/15/25) before a ballet performance at nearby McCaw Hall. We planned to eat a little over an hour beforehand as we've done at many other restaurants in the past without any issues.
I called ahead and made a 6:15pm reservation and when we got there I dropped my wife off at the restaurant while I parked. By the time I got into the restaurant I found that my wife still hadn't been seated. She told me that there was only 1 server who was also acting as hostess and online order pickup cashier. So, it took us like 5+ minutes to be seated even though we had a reservation, and then it took almost another 15 minutes before the lone server/hostess/cashier took our order. Long story short....we barely had enough time to scarf down our food before having to head out so that we could get to the performance in time. We couldn't even take our leftovers to the car (as was part of our original plan) as we were cutting it too close on time now. So like $65 for a rushed, half-eaten dinner.
To be clear, I'm not blaming the staff for this poor experience. It seems that management (or the owner) decided that a single server in a popular restaurant on a Saturday night is fine. I'm sure they just don't want to pay more to actually have the right number of people working. I feel bad for the staff but management is 100% to blame for this....and I saw that we weren't the only annoyed customers there.
